Italy Nativity Scene Debate

In a striking development that’s ignited widespread debate across Italy, a vast number of citizens have rallied, urging the Catholic Church to denounce a daring nativity display showcased at the Church of Saints Peter and Paul in Avellino. This unique portrayal of the Christmas story features baby Jesus cradled by two mothers, diverging from the customary depiction of Mary and Joseph. The scene garnered attention following a pro-life group’s highlighting of its unconventional nature. Read full article

